A terrorist was killed on Friday in a meeting with security forces in the district of Jammu and Kashmir in Kishwar, while a separate operation to locate a group of three militants is underway in the Udhampur district, army officials said.
Security agencies have expanded the scope of surveillance to the Bhaderwah area of the Doda district to maintain a clue about the potential terrorist movement between different places in the mountainous districts of the Jammu region.

According to reports, the murdered terrorist was part of the Saifullah module of Pakistan, but has not officially confirmed his leg. This is the module that ambushed an army team in Doda on July 15, 2024, which resulted in the death of an officer and a rifle.
The security forces have intensive surveillance in the areas of great altitude of the Bhaderwah area of the Doda district, considering the snow melted in the highest meadows, an important factor that contributes to the duration of the infiltration of the summer monms.
With the support of helicopters and drones, the troops maintain a high degree of surveillance in the areas of great altitude that connect the districts of Kishwar, Udhampur and Kathua, they said.
There are five meetings bone in the last 19 days on the mountain lands of Kathua-Durhampur-Kishwar, in which three terrorists killed. Four police personnel were also killed, while other police personnel and a girl suffered wounds.
Search operations resumed Friday at the Jopher-Marta forests in the Udhampur district, authorities said.
Equipped with tracker dogs and aerial surveillance, multiple security agencies are combing the entire forest area to locate three terrorists who hide in the area, they added.
